Journal: Protein engineering, design & selection : PEDS

Article Title: Evolution of interleukin-15 for higher E. coli expression and solubility.

doi: 10.1093/protein/gzq107

Figure Lengend Snippet: Fig. 2 Results of second-step screening process of IL-15-CAT fusions when expressed in E. coli DH5a. The vertical axis (solubility test) corresponds to the ELISA absorbance of cell extracts incubated in plates coated with Mab247, revealed with an anti-CAT polyclonal antibody. The horizontal axis (functionality test) corresponds to the ELISA absorbance of cell extracts incubated in plates coated with IL-15Ra and revealed with Mab247. Filled squares represent clones selected at cam ,400 mM; filled circle, clones selected at cam 800 mM; filled triangle, clones selected at cam 1200 mM; open square, clones selected at cam 1500 mM.

Article Snippet: To screen mutants for their solubility, a sandwich ELISA test was used with Mab247 (anti-human IL-15 IgG, R&D system), dilution 1 mg/ml, as the capture antibody and a two-step detection system with a polyclonal rabbit anti-CAT IgG (Sigma) and a goat anti-rabbit IgG conjugated with peroxidase (Sigma).
